Basement stabilization services involve techniques and solutions designed to strengthen and support the foundation of a property’s basement. When a basement begins to shift, crack, or settle, stabilization methods can help restore structural integrity and prevent further damage. These services typically include installing support systems such as underpinning, piers, or braces that reinforce the existing foundation. By addressing the root causes of foundation movement, these solutions aim to create a safer and more stable environment within the basement space.
Many common problems signal the need for basement stabilization. These include visible cracks in basement walls or floors, uneven flooring above the basement, doors or windows that no longer close properly, and noticeable shifts or bulges in the foundation. Such issues often result from soil movement, water infiltration, or changes in moisture levels that cause the ground beneath the foundation to expand or contract. Recognizing these signs early can help prevent more serious structural damage and costly repairs down the line.
Properties that typically benefit from basement stabilization are often older homes, homes built on expansive or poorly compacted soil, or properties that have experienced shifting due to weather changes or water issues. The overview below groups typical Basement Stabilization proj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Granger, IN.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or basement stabilization work in Granger often range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le tier, covering small cracks or localized support.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this range unless additional work is needed.
Moderate Projects - Medium-sized stabilization projects usually c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These often involve reinforcing larger sections of the basement or addressing moderate foundation issues, which are common for many homeowners in the area.
Large-Scale Stabilization - Larger or more complex projects, such as significant foundation underpinning or extensive wall repairs, can range from $3,500 to $8,000. These projects are less frequent but necessary for severe foundation concerns or extensive basement issues.
Full Basement Reinforcement - Complete stabilization or foundation replacement projects typically exceed $10,000 and can reach $20,000+ depending on the scope. Local contractors handling such jobs often see these as specialized, less common projects requiring detailed planning and resources.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is basement stabilization? Basement stabilization involves techniques to strengthen and support a basement's foundation to prevent or repair settling, cracking, or shifting issues.
How can basement stabilization benefit my home? Proper stabilization can help maintain the structural integrity of a basement, prevent further damage, and protect the overall safety of a property.
What methods do local contractors use for basement stabilization? Contractors may use methods such as underpinning, wall braces, soil stabilization, or piering systems to reinforce and stabilize basement foundations.
Are basement stabilization services suitable for existing homes? Yes, these services are often performed on existing homes experiencing foundation issues or signs of settling and shifting.
